What is Parent Orientation?
Parent Orientation is a program designed to give you, the parents, the tools to help your new post secondary students succeed. This year we have two different options for you to attend, and one for your daughter or son too!

Where is Parent Orientation?
Parent Orientation takes place in two different locations. Lister Centre is located on the corner of 87 Avenue and 116 Street. The Engineering Teaching and Learning Complex (ETLC) is located on 116 Street, just north of 91 Avenure, with the public entrance on the northeast corner of the building.
